To enable it do the following ```bash sudo a2enmod rewrite -sudo service apache2 or apache or httpd restart ``` +After enabling the rewite module you will need to restart apache. + ## Upgrading buildkit {:#upgrading} New versions of buildkit are likely to include new versions of tools. The new tools will download automatically when you first run `civibuild`. If you prefer to download explicitly, then re-run `civi-download-tools`.
